Pork Tonkatsu
Serves
2
Total Time
30 minutes
Prep Time
20 minutes
Cook Time
10 minutes
Ingredients
Oil for Frying
1 pound boneless pork chops
Salt and pepper to taste
1 cup all-purpose flour
2 eggs
1 cup Kikkoman® Panko Bread Crumbs
½ small cabbage
3 tablespoons sesame dressing
3 cups cooked rice
4 tablespoons Kikkoman® Katsu Sauce
Directions
- Preheat frying oil in a large pot to 350°F.
- Pound 2 pieces of boneless pork chops until ¼ inch thick. Season with salt and pepper on both sides.
- Prepare 3 separate breading trays with all-purpose flour, 2 eggs, and 1 cup of panko. Dip the boneless pork chop in the flour, then egg wash, then the panko. Press firmly into the panko to cover all bare spots on the pork chops
- Fry the pork chops for 7-8 minutes, then let rest on a wire rack for 5-10 minutes before cutting
- Thinly chop ½ of a small cabbage. Serve the cabbage topped with sesame dressing with a side of rice, pork cutlet and katsu sauce.
